Title: Environmental, Health & Safety Coordinator (EH&S)
Location: Springfield, OH
Description:
Under the general direction of the General Manager of Human Resources, directs the development and implementation of environmental, health, safety, security and regulatory compliance programs. Insures compliance with all federal, state and local regulations and standards involving environmental management, chemical control, industrial hygiene, general safety and fire safety. Oversees management of all worker’s compensation claims against the company and participates in the review of worker’s compensation litigation. Reviews and analyzes data and devises risk minimization programs.
D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
• Provides leadership and direction in all areas of EHS regulatory compliance.
• Establishes and implements short- and long-range organizational goals, objectives, policies, and procedures; monitors and evaluates programmatic and operational effectiveness, and effects changes required for improvement for EH&S programs.
• Develops and manages annual budgets for the EH&S programs and performs periodic cost analyses.
• Advises Security on appropriate management policies, procedures, and issues of safety.
• Coordinates OSHA and other required training programs targeted to reduce employee injuries and lost work time.
• Keeps abreast of pending regulatory developments through reference sources; obtains insight on legislative agendas at state and federal levels.
• Recommends, participates in the development of, and establishes the company EHS policies and procedures; serves as an advisor to the engineering department relating to the design and construction of physical facilities relating to EH&S issues.
• Performs miscellaneous job-related duties as assigned
• Travel required
